Water Mill House Care Home provides expert care to adults (18+) with a range of support needs including rehab following a stroke or amputation, paralysis, Muscular Dystrophy, Multiple Sclerosis and Parkinson’s. The dedicated team also delivers residential, nursing and dementia care with love and kindness whilst holding platinum accreditation under the Gold Standards Framework for compassionate end-of-life care.

Residents are supported to try new activities and rediscover former hobbies. From music and movement sessions, reminiscence projects, to brain gym, and make a wish initiative, there is truly something for everyone. As well as frequent excursions to local places of interest on the minibus and visits from entertainers, schoolchildren and the ‘Newt Brigade’, the home’s preschool group.

Water Mill House is a stimulating environment that promotes independence. Set over three floors, the spacious home with state-of-the-art gym, equipped with cardio machines, resistance equipment and stretching aids, ensures a comprehensive approach to rehabilitation, enabling community clinicians, physiotherapists and the home’s care team to work in partnership. Together they create and review personalised care plans that maximise each resident's rehabilitation potential, promoting their physical recovery, improving mobility, and enhancing communication skills.

Families are an integral part of life at the home, which boasts beautiful en-suite bedrooms, a bustling bistro, sunny rooftop terrace and on-site library, cinema, spa and hair salon. All surrounded by tranquil landscaped gardens with scenic views of the Hertfordshire countryside.

The team receives comprehensive training and professional development to deliver the high standards of holistic care residents and families deserve. In November 2023, it was a finalist in the Dignity in Care category at the East of England Great British Care Awards 2023.

My Mum lived for the last 2.5 years of her life on the dementia level. It became her home. The staff caring for her genuinely bonded with her and she with them. Immediately we saw the huge change in her level of happiness and contentment as she benefitted from the companionship of being around people
(not just the carers, but the other residents too) and the enjoyment of being able to take part in the activities offered there. As a visitor, if Mum was already happily engaged in an activity, I would be welcome to join in. The Bistro and garden are lovely. I was always impressed with how well-groomed Mum was, with her hair freshly cut in a variety of styles that really suited her. When she deteriorated very suddenly, we were kept informed and we were able to spend the whole day with her, the end of life care given in the room she had always had; no need to move her to the nursing floor. Staff supported us throughout that day with kindness and sensitivity.

The Review Score of 9.9 (9.880) out of 10 for Water Mill House Care Home is based on a) the Average Rating and b) the number of positive Reviews.

  • a) The Average Rating is 4.9 out of 5 from 26 Reviews in the last 24 months.

  • b) The score for the number of positive Reviews is 5.0 out of 5 from 26 positive Reviews in the last 24 months.

Detailed Breakdown of Review Score

The maximum Review Score for a Care Home is 10, which is made up from the Average Rating of Reviews (maximum of 5 points) and the Number of Reviews (maximum of 5 points) in the last 24 months:

  • a) 5 Points are available for the Average Rating from all Reviews in the last 24 months.

    The Average Rating of 4.880 for Water Mill House Care Home is calculated as follows: ( (275 Excellents x 5) + (31 Goods x 4) + (3 Satisfactorys x 3) ) ÷ 309 Ratings = 4.88

  • b) 5 Points are available for the number of Positive Reviews in the last 24 months. A Positive Review is defined as any Review with an 'Overall Experience' of '4' or '5' (out of a max rating '5').

    The 5 Points relating to the number of positive Reviews for Water Mill House Care Home is based on 26 positive Reviews in the last 24 months and is calculated as per below:

    The 5 points available are broken down as follows:

    • i) 4 points are available for the first 10 Positive Reviews in the last 24 months; 3 points for the first Positive Review, and then 0.125 Points for each of the next four Positive Reviews and then 0.1 Points for the next five Positive Reviews. (1st = 3.000, 2nd = 0.125, 3rd = 0.125, 4th = 0.125, 5th = 0.125, 6th = 0.100, 7th = 0.100, 8th = 0.100, 9th = 0.100, 10th = 0.100) 3 + 0.125 + 0.125 + 0.125 + 0.125 + 0.1 + 0.1 + 0.1 + 0.1 + 0.1 = 4

    • ii) 1 point is available for the number of Positive Reviews reaching 20% of the registered maximum number of service users in the last 24 months. If this number is partially reached, then that proportion of 1 point is given. eg a Care Home registered for a maximum of 50 service users has to reach 10 Positive Reviews to receive 1 point, if it has 7 reviews it will receive 0.7 points. 20% of the 70 registered maximum number of service users is 14, which has been reached with 26 Positive reviews. Points = 1

  • When a Review is submitted by someone who has previously submitted a Review, only the latest Review will count towards the Review Score.

  • If a Care Home does not have a review in the last 24 months, then it will not have a Review Score.
